A narrative review on the psychosocial domains of the impact of organ transplantation. DISCOVER MENTAL HEALTH 2025; 5:20. [PMID: 39992446 PMCID: PMC11850674 DOI: 10.1007/s44192-025-00148-y]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Subscribe] [Scholar Register] [Received: 07/20/2024] [Accepted: 02/18/2025] [Indexed: 02/25/2025]
Abstract
This review explores organ transplantation, spanning historical developments, psychosocial impacts, and future directions. In the pre-transplantation phase, evaluations of psychosocial factors, including substance use, mental health, and social support, are essential for successful outcomes. However, linking total psychosocial risk scores to post-transplant outcomes remains challenging despite available tools and assessments. Patient selection criteria and psychological assessments are pivotal in achieving successful transplantation outcomes. The age of donors significantly impacts transplant outcomes across various organs, highlighting the urgency of addressing organ shortages. Meticulous patient selection, including thorough psychosocial evaluations, ensures recipients possess the necessary emotional resilience and support systems for successful transplantation. Both pre- and post-transplantation psychological evaluation processes are crucial for assessing and supporting individuals throughout the transplant journey. Posttransplant evaluations continue to monitor adjustment difficulties, medication adherence, and complex emotions, enabling timely intervention and personalized support. The waiting period before transplantation presents significant challenges, including uncertainty, anxiety, and social isolation. Robust emotional support and coping mechanisms are crucial during this transitional phase, fostering resilience and hope among waitlist candidates. Psychological challenges during and after transplantation, including anxiety, depression, and sleep disturbances, are common among recipients. Coping mechanisms, such as religious/spiritual approaches, social support, and participation in support groups, play pivotal roles in patient adjustment and recovery. Ethical considerations are paramount in ensuring fair and effective transplantation practices, including organ allocation, adherence to post-transplant care, financial burdens, and the interplay between medical and psychosocial factors.

Developing and Expanding Deceased Organ Donation to Its Maximum Therapeutic Potential: An Actionable Global Challenge From the 2023 Santander Summit. Transplantation 2025; 109:10-21. [PMID: 39437375 DOI: 10.1097/tp.0000000000005234]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/25/2024]
Abstract
On November 9 and 10, 2023, the Organización Nacional de Trasplantes (ONT), under the Spanish Presidency of the Council of the European Union, convened in Santander a Global Summit entitled "Towards Global Convergence in Transplantation: Sufficiency, Transparency and Oversight." This article summarizes two distinct but related challenges elaborated at the Santander Summit by Working Group 2 that must be overcome if we are to develop and expand deceased donation worldwide and achieve the goal of self-sufficiency in organ donation and transplantation. Challenge 1: the need for a unified concept of death based on the permanent cessation of brain function. Working group 2 proposed that challenge 1 requires the global community to work toward a uniform, worldwide definition of human death, conceptually unifying circulatory and neurological criteria of death around the cessation of brain function and accepting that permanent cessation of brain function is a valid criterion to determine death. Challenge 2: reducing disparities in deceased donation and increasing organ utilization through donation after the circulatory determination of death (DCDD). Working group 2 proposed that challenge 2 requires the global community to work toward increasing organ utilization through DCDD, expanding DCDD through in situ normothermic regional perfusion, and expanding DCDD through ex situ machine organ perfusion technology. Recommendations for implementation are described.

Koo DC, Scalise PN, Chiu MZ, Staffa SJ, Demehri FR, Cuenca AG, Kim HB, Lee EJ. Effect of citizenship status on access to pediatric liver and kidney transplantation. Am J Transplant 2024; 24:1868-1880. [PMID: 38908484 DOI: 10.1016/j.ajt.2024.06.008]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/28/2023] [Revised: 05/09/2024] [Accepted: 06/11/2024] [Indexed: 06/24/2024]
Abstract
Transplantation of non-US citizen residents remains controversial. We evaluate national trends in transplant activity among pediatric noncitizen residents (PNCR). Pediatric liver and kidney transplant data were obtained from the Organ Procurement and Transplantation Network and the Scientific Registry of Transplant Recipients. Data on transplanted organs, region, waitlist additions, procedures, and citizenship status were analyzed from 2012-2022. Rates of PNCR transplantation activity were compared with population rates from the US Census Bureau. On average, 713 ± 47 pediatric liver and 1039 ± 51 kidney patients were added to the waitlist, with 544 ± 32 liver and 742 ± 33 kidney transplants performed annually. Of these, PNCR comprised 1.5% and 3.3% of liver and kidney waitlist additions and 1.5% and 2.9% of liver and kidney transplant procedures, respectively. There were no significant changes in waitlist or transplant activity nationwide over the study period. There was a significant geographic variation in the percentage of waitlist additions and transplants across the United Network for Organ Sharing regions among the PNCR for liver and kidney transplantation. This is the first study to evaluate national trends in transplantation activity among PNCRs. The significant regional variation in transplantation activity for PNCR may suggest multilevel structural and systemic barriers to transplant accessibility.

Developing Guidance for Donor Intervention Randomized Controlled Trials: Initial Discussions From the Canada-United Kingdom 2022 Workshop. Transplantation 2024; 108:1776-1781. [PMID: 38499505 DOI: 10.1097/tp.0000000000004983]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 03/20/2024]
Abstract
BACKGROUND Donor interventions, including medications, protocols, and medical devices administered to donors, can enhance transplantable organ quality and quantity and maximize transplantation success. However, there is paucity of high-quality evidence about their effectiveness, in part because of ethical, practical, and regulatory challenges, and lack of guidance about conduct of donor intervention randomized controlled trials (RCTs). METHODS With the vision to develop authoritative guidance for conduct of donor intervention RCTs, we convened a workshop of Canadian-United Kingdom experts in organ donation and transplantation ethics, research, and policy to identify stakeholders, explore unique challenges, and develop research agenda to inform future work in this promising field. RESULTS Donor intervention trials should consider perspectives of broad group of stakeholders including donors, transplant recipients, and their families; researchers in donation and transplantation; research ethics boards; and healthcare providers and administrators involved in donation and transplantation. Unique challenges include (1) research ethics (living versus deceased status of the donor at the time of intervention, intervention versus outcomes assessment in different individuals, harm-benefit analysis in donors versus recipients, consent, and impact on research bystanders); (2) outcome data standardization and linkage; and (3) regulatory and governance considerations. CONCLUSIONS Donor intervention RCTs hold potential to benefit organ transplantation outcomes but face unique research ethics, outcome data, and regulatory challenges. By developing research agenda to address these challenges, our workshop was an important first step toward developing Canada-United Kingdom guidance for donor intervention RCTs that are poised to improve the quality and availability of transplantable organs.

Ng QX, Lim YL, Xin X, Ong C, Ng WK, Thumboo J, Tan HK. What is said about #donateliver or #liverdonor? Reflexive thematic analysis of Twitter (X) posts from 2012 to 2022. BMC Public Health 2024; 24:1904. [PMID: 39014341 PMCID: PMC11250948 DOI: 10.1186/s12889-024-19381-1]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/18/2024] [Accepted: 07/05/2024] [Indexed: 07/18/2024] Open
Abstract
BACKGROUND There is sustained interest in understanding the perspectives of liver transplant recipients and living donors, with several qualitative studies shedding light on this emotionally charged subject. However, these studies have relied primarily on traditional semi-structured interviews, which, while valuable, come with inherent limitations. Consequently, there remains a gap in our comprehension of the broader public discourse surrounding living liver donation. This study aims to bridge this gap by delving into public conversations related to living liver donation through a qualitative analysis of Twitter (now X) posts, offering a fresh perspective on this critical issue. METHODS To compile a comprehensive dataset, we extracted original tweets containing the hashtags "#donateliver" OR "#liverdonor", all posted in English from January 1, 2012, to December 31, 2022. We then selected tweets from individual users whose Twitter (X) accounts featured authentic human names, ensuring the credibility of our data. Employing Braun and Clarke's reflexive thematic analysis approach, the study investigators read and analysed the included tweets, identifying two main themes and six subthemes. The Health Policy Triangle framework was applied to understand the roles of different stakeholders involved in the discourse and suggest areas for policy improvement. RESULTS A total of 361 unique tweets from individual users were analysed. The major theme that emerged was the persistent shortage of liver donors, underscoring the desperation faced by individuals in need of life-saving liver transplants and the urgency of addressing the organ shortage problem. The second theme delved into the experiences of liver donors post-surgery, shedding light on a variety of aspects related to the transplantation process, including the visibility of surgical scars, and the significance of returning to physical activity and exercise post-surgery. CONCLUSION The multifaceted experiences of individuals involved in the transplantation process, both recipients and donors, should be further studied in our efforts to improve the critical shortage of liver donors.

Lewis A. An Update on Brain Death/Death by Neurologic Criteria since the World Brain Death Project. Semin Neurol 2024; 44:236-262. [PMID: 38621707 DOI: 10.1055/s-0044-1786020]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 04/17/2024]
Abstract
The World Brain Death Project (WBDP) is a 2020 international consensus statement that provides historical background and recommendations on brain death/death by neurologic criteria (BD/DNC) determination. It addresses 13 topics including: (1) worldwide variance in BD/DNC, (2) the science of BD/DNC, (3) the concept of BD/DNC, (4) minimum clinical criteria for BD/DNC determination, (5) beyond minimum clinical BD/DNC determination, (6) pediatric and neonatal BD/DNC determination, (7) BD/DNC determination in patients on ECMO, (8) BD/DNC determination after treatment with targeted temperature management, (9) BD/DNC documentation, (10) qualification for and education on BD/DNC determination, (11) somatic support after BD/DNC for organ donation and other special circumstances, (12) religion and BD/DNC: managing requests to forego a BD/DNC evaluation or continue somatic support after BD/DNC, and (13) BD/DNC and the law. This review summarizes the WBDP content on each of these topics and highlights relevant work published from 2020 to 2023, including both the 192 citing publications and other publications on BD/DNC. Finally, it reviews questions for future research related to BD/DNC and emphasizes the need for national efforts to ensure the minimum standards for BD/DNC determination described in the WBDP are included in national BD/DNC guidelines and due consideration is given to the recommendations about social and legal aspects of BD/DNC determination.

Understanding the dynamics of deceased organ donation and utilization in Colombia. Rev Panam Salud Publica 2024; 48:e24. [PMID: 38464873 PMCID: PMC10921909 DOI: 10.26633/rpsp.2024.24]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/01/2023] [Accepted: 12/19/2023] [Indexed: 03/12/2024] Open
Abstract
Objective To obtain a comprehensive overview of organ donation, organ utilization, and discard in the entire donation process in Colombia. Methods A retrospective study of 1 451 possible donors, distributed in three regions of Colombia, evaluated in 2022. The general characteristics, diagnosis, and causes of contraindication for potential donors were described. Results Among the 1 451 possible donors, 441 (30.4%) fulfilled brain death criteria, constituting the potential donor pool. Families consented to organ donation in 141 medically suitable cases, while 60 instances utilized legal presumption, leading to 201 eligible donors (13.9%). Of those, 160 (11.0%) were actual donors (in whom operative incision was made with the intent of organ recovery or who had at least one organ recovered). Finally, we identified 147 utilized donors (10.1%) (from whom at least one organ was transplanted). Statistically significant differences were found between age, sex, diagnosis of brain death, and donor critical pathway between regions. A total of 411 organs were transplanted from 147 utilized donors, with kidneys being the most frequently procured and transplanted organs, accounting for 280 (68.1%) of the total. This was followed by 85 livers (20.7%), 31 hearts (7.5%), 14 lungs (3.4%), and 1 pancreas (0.2%). The discard rate of procured deceased donors was 8.1%. Conclusions About one-tenth of donors are effectively used for transplantation purposes. Our findings highlight areas of success and challenges, providing a basis for future improvements in Colombia.

Development of the Nova Scotia Potential Donor Audit (PDA) Tool and 2020 Historic Performance Database: Lessons Learned From the First 1000 Medical Record Reviews. Transplant Direct 2023; 9:e1545. [PMID: 37876919 PMCID: PMC10593262 DOI: 10.1097/txd.0000000000001545]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/04/2023] [Revised: 07/26/2023] [Accepted: 08/21/2023] [Indexed: 10/26/2023] Open
Abstract
Background Legislation and accountability frameworks are key components of high-performing deceased-donation systems. In 2021, Nova Scotia (NS), Canada, became the first jurisdiction in North America to enact deemed consent legislation and concurrently implemented mandatory referral legislation similar to that found in other Canadian provinces. Frontline financial resources were provided by the government to support the development of program infrastructure, including implementation of means to evaluate system performance. Methods The Organ Donation Program (ODP), in collaboration with other stakeholders, developed a Potential Donor Audit (PDA) tool and database for referral intake and manual performance audits. Medical record reviews of deaths in the year before legislative change were conducted to pilot and revise the PDA and evaluate missed donation opportunities. Results The NS PDA was piloted on 1028 patient deaths. Of 518 patients (50.4%) who met clinical triggers for referral to the ODP, 72 (13.9%) were referred (86.1% missed referral rate). One hundred sixty-three patients met the NS definition of a potential donor; 53 (32.5%) were referred (110 missed potential donors). Referral consent rates reached 71.7% (n = 38 of 53 approaches). The actualized donation rate reported by Canadian Blood Services was 29.9 donors per million population (n = 34 donors). Discussion We documented high rates of missed referrals and missed potential donors before the enactment of mandatory referral and deemed consent legislation. Conclusions The ODP has intentionally broadened clinical criteria for referral to shift the responsibility of identifying medically suitable potential donors from bedside clinicians to organ donation specialists. Lessons learned from our experience developing a PDA include the importance of early involvement of multiple stakeholders and ongoing modification of fields and workflow based on data availability and utility for clinical, educational, research, and reporting purposes.

Organ Donation Organization Architecture: Recommendations From an International Consensus Forum. Transplant Direct 2023; 9:e1440. [PMID: 37138552 PMCID: PMC10150918 DOI: 10.1097/txd.0000000000001440] [Citation(s) in RCA: 5]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/12/2022] [Revised: 12/12/2022] [Accepted: 12/14/2022] [Indexed: 05/05/2023] Open
Abstract
This report contains recommendations from 1 of 7 domains of the International Donation and Transplantation Legislative and Policy Forum (the Forum). The purpose is to provide expert guidance on the structure and function of Organ and Tissue Donation and Transplantation (OTDT) systems. The intended audience is OTDT stakeholders working to establish or improve existing systems. Methods The Forum was initiated by Transplant Québec and co-hosted by the Canadian Donation and Transplantation Program partnered with multiple national and international donation and transplantation organizations. This domain group included administrative, clinical, and academic experts in OTDT systems and 3 patient, family, and donor partners. We identified topic areas and recommendations through consensus, using the nominal group technique. Selected topics were informed by narrative literature reviews and vetted by the Forum's scientific committee. We presented these recommendations publicly, with delegate feedback being incorporated into the final report. Results This report has 33 recommendations grouped into 10 topic areas. Topic areas include the need for public and professional education, processes to assure timely referral of patients who are potential donors, and processes to ensure that standards are properly enforced. Conclusions The recommendations encompass the multiple roles organ donation organizations play in the donation and transplantation process. We recognize the diversity of local conditions but believe that they could be adapted and applied by organ donation organizations across the world to accomplish their fundamental objectives of assuring that everyone who desires to become an organ donor is given that opportunity in a safe, equitable, and transparent manner.
